 in·de·fat·i·ga·ble /ˌɪndɪˈfætɪgəbəl/

 In·de·fat·i·ga·ble a.  Incapable of being fatigued; not readily exhausted; unremitting in labor or effort; untiring; unwearying; not yielding to fatigue; as, indefatigable exertions, perseverance, application. “A constant, indefatigable attendance.”
    Upborne with indefatigable wings.   --Milton.
 Syn: -- Unwearied; untiring; persevering; persistent.

      adj : showing sustained enthusiastic action with unflagging
            vitality; "an indefatigable advocate of equal rights";
            "a tireless worker"; "unflagging pursuit of excellence"
            [syn: tireless, unflagging, unwearying]